I just picked up one of these .. It comes in different color schemes, and I got one with a med. gray d-pad and silver-paint case.

The screen is surprisingly bright and decent resolution for such a tiny size. Most of the games are ass though, but maybe 10-12 are decent fun for a quick 5-minute play (Bubble bobble clone, cart racing ... tetris, breakout, bejeweled clones) .. basically a collection of mediocre java games.

Not bad at all for $30. As for using the d-pad as a mod for the GP2X, it feels flimsy and cheap, I doubt it would fare any better than the stock stick. :p
